Structural Foundation Repair in Milton, MA
Structural fo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's foundation. These services typically cover projects such as stabilizing settling foundations, repairing cracks, and addressing uneven or bowing walls. Property owners often seek this type of repair when noticing signs like cracks in walls, uneven floors, or doors and windows that no longer close properly, as these can indicate underlying foundation problems that may worsen without intervention.
Before requesting foundation repair, homeowners usually want to understand the scope of the work needed, the potential causes of foundation issues, and the types of repair methods available. It’s important to assess whether the problem is due to soil movement, moisture changes, or structural shifts, and to determine if repairs will involve underpinning, wall reinforcement, or other techniques. Clear communication about the condition of the foundation and the recommended solutions can help property owners make informed decisions to protect their investment.

Common Structural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ation Stabilization - techniques to prevent further settling and maintain structural integrity.
Concrete Piering - installing piers beneath the foundation to lift and support sinking areas.
Wall Repair - fixing cracked or bowed basement and crawl space walls caused by shifting soil.
Mudjack/Slab Jacking - lifting and leveling uneven concrete slabs to restore a flat surface.
Drainage Solutions - improving water flow around the foundation to reduce soil pressure and moisture issues.
Leak and Crack Sealing - sealing foundation cracks to prevent water intrusion and further damage.
Structural Foundation Repair Questions
What are signs of foundation problems? Common signs include c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and sticking doors or windows.
What causes foundation issues? Factors such as soil movement, poor drainage, and age can lead to foundation settlement or shifting.
How is foundation repair performed? Repairs often involve stabilizing the foundation with piers, underpinning, or wall reinforcement techniques.
When should property owners consider foundation repair? It is advisable to evaluate repairs when signs of movement or damage are noticeable to prevent further issues.
